As a new contractor on the Paritywren project, your first task involves the rate-parity checker, which compares nightly hotel rates across partner channels and flags discrepancies above the configured threshold. Please read the crawler etiquette guide before running any scans, and always use the sandbox dataset until your access review completes. Deployments to the staging environment are gated by signed manifests, so every build you submit must be verifiable. The deploy key you will use for signing staging manifests is provided below.

rollout seal: bky9_PeXH1fTLY

14:22 — The Gaugepost metrics sidecar on the Ferncliff cluster began dropping aggregation windows after a config push doubled the flush interval. For context (especially if you're new): the sidecar buffers per-pod counters and flushes to the Tallyhouse backend, so a longer interval silently inflated memory until the OOM killer intervened at 14:31. Dashboards showed gaps rather than errors, which delayed detection. We rolled back at 14:40 and confirmed recovery against the rollback artifact, whose trace token is recorded below.

session token of fafof-bahof = htk9_cde2d95fb

Handover: Exportron retry queue

Hi Mira — handing over the failed-export retries. Exports that hit a timeout land in the retry queue and get three attempts with backoff; after that they're parked and need a manual requeue from the admin panel. Watch for customers reporting duplicates — that usually means a double requeue. The current retry settings are as follows.

settings of bajog-fawig:
oliael:
  log_level: warn
  metrics_host: metrics.oliael.zemvarsys.internal
  pin: 0267
  pool_size: 32

## Changelog — Furrowgate 3.2

Changed defaults for the Furrowgate telemetry gateway. Batch uploads now compress by default; retry backoff switched from linear to exponential; idle tractors report at the low-power interval. Review note: these defaults apply only to nodes without explicit overrides, so fleet-level manifests are untouched. Migration is automatic on restart. The new default configuration shipped with this release is shown below.

config for kagup-hahig:
druwyn:
  pin: 2801
  metrics_host: metrics.druwyn.zemvarlabs.internal
  tenant: sorius
  seal: seal_798a43d7